Gour University, Sagar (M.P) A paragraph on area of interest Infectious diseases remain an area of concern for health. My interests lie in the field of infectious diseases especially bacterial and mycological infections related with HIV disease. I have taken up tuberculosis to work with as a priority. My efforts are to support and inform future drug development by exploring the pattern of conservation in existing and newly proposed drug targets. To begin with, I have picked up a few well known and validated targets for future drugs. Another least travelled road has lead me to explore if gut microbial communities have any role to play in HIV disease progression. With the availability of next generation sequencing technology, it has become possible and feasible enough to identify such communities in a given sample. For both the above projects use of bioinformatics can help a lot and hence I have tried using related software to predict and explain the outcomes of my work.
